Angela Iannitelli is a scholar working on Psychiatry and Mental health,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and Clinical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Angela Iannitelli has authored 68 papers receiving a total of 963 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Psychiatry and Mental health, 15 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and 15 papers in Clinical Psychology. Recurrent topics in Angela Iannitelli's work include Nerve injury and regeneration (14 papers), Schizophrenia research and treatment (8 papers) and Neurogenesis and neuroplasticity mechanisms (8 papers). Angela Iannitelli is often cited by papers focused on Nerve injury and regeneration (14 papers), Schizophrenia research and treatment (8 papers) and Neurogenesis and neuroplasticity mechanisms (8 papers). Angela Iannitelli coll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and Bulgaria. Angela Iannitelli's co-authors include Giuseppe Bersani, Luigi Aloe, Marco Fiore, Francesco Angelucci, Adele Quartini, Paola Tirassa, Francesca Pacitti, Pamela Rosso, Mauro Ceccanti and Antonio Greco and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, International Journal of Molecular Sciences and Neuroscience & Biobehavioral Reviews.
